  • Lewis acid-mediated reactions of 1-cyclopropyl-2-arylethanone derivatives with diethyl 2-oxomalonate and ethyl 2-oxoacetate

    TMSOTf-mediated reactions of 2-aryl-1-(1-phenylcyclopropyl)ethanones 1 with diethyl 2-oxomalonate 2 afford a novel method for the synthesis of spiro-γ-lactone derivatives 3 in good to excellent yields via a sequential reaction involving a nucleophilic ring-opening reaction of the cyclopropane by H2O, an aldol-type reaction and a cyclic transesterification mediated by Lewis acid. On the other hand, we found that TMSOTf-mediated reactions of 1-cyclopropyl-2-arylethanones 1 with ethyl 2-oxoacetate 4 could also provide the corresponding spiro-γ-lactone derivatives 5 in moderate yields along with another spiro-γ-lactone derivatives 6 derived from the reaction of 1 with two molecules of ethyl 2-oxoacetate. The plausible reaction mechanisms have also been provided on the basis of control experiments.
